1. Understanding Aluminium Extrusion
Aluminium extrusion is a manufacturing process that transforms aluminium alloy into a usable product. The process involves forcing heated aluminium through a die, creating a specific cross-sectional profile. This method is renowned for its efficiency and cost-effectiveness, making it an ideal choice for producing complex shapes.
Extrusion allows for high precision and can accommodate a variety of designs, making it suitable for numerous industries, from electronics to automotive. The continued evolution of extrusion technology has expanded the possibilities for custom designs, allowing engineers and designers to create enclosures that meet specific functional and aesthetic requirements.
2. Benefits of Aluminium Extruded Enclosures
Customising aluminium extruded enclosures offers a plethora of benefits, including:
Durability and Strength
Aluminium is naturally resistant to corrosion, making it exceptionally durable in various environmental conditions. This durability ensures that the enclosures can withstand impact and harsh conditions, prolonging the lifespan of electronic devices and components housed within.
Lightweight Properties
Aluminium is significantly lighter than steel, which helps reduce transportation costs and makes installation easier. This lightweight nature is particularly beneficial in applications where weight savings are essential, like aerospace and automotive industries.
Design Flexibility
With the extrusion process, manufacturers can create custom shapes and sizes that align with specific project requirements. This flexibility allows for innovative designs that can enhance product function and improve user experience.
Cost-Effectiveness
Custom aluminium extrusions can be economically advantageous, especially for large production runs. The initial setup costs can be offset by the long-term benefits of durability and reduced manufacturing time.
3. Design Considerations for Custom Enclosures
When embarking on the customisation of aluminium extruded enclosures, several design considerations must be taken into account:
Dimensions and Size
Start by determining the necessary dimensions and sizes that will accommodate the components you wish to enclose. Consider the internal layout and ensure that there is adequate space for wiring, connectors, and any additional features.
Thermal Management
Effective thermal management is crucial for the longevity and performance of electronic components. Incorporating features like ventilation holes or heat sinks can enhance airflow and dissipation of heat, preventing overheating.
Mounting Options
Decide how the enclosure will be mounted or installed. Options may include brackets, flanges, or integrated mounting points within the extrusion itself. Thoughtful design ensures easy installation and maintenance.
Access Points
Consider how users will access the enclosure. Designing access points for easy assembly and maintenance can significantly improve the user experience. Doors, panels, or removable covers can facilitate this process.
4. Customisation Options for Aluminium Extruded Enclosures
The customisation options for aluminium extruded enclosures are extensive. Here are some of the most popular:
Extrusion Profiles
Selecting the right extrusion profile is paramount. Custom profiles can be created to meet specific operational needs, allowing for unique shapes that either enhance functionality or contribute to aesthetic appeal.
Surface Treatments
Surface treatments enhance the enclosure's durability and appearance. Options include anodizing, powder coating, or brushing. Each treatment offers distinct advantages, from corrosion resistance to improved aesthetics.
Integrated Features
Incorporating integrated features such as cable management systems, mounting brackets, or grommets can help streamline the design process and add value to the final product.
Color and Finish
Customization is not limited to shape and size; color and finish play a vital role in branding and product aesthetics. Custom colors can be achieved through various methods, including powder coating and anodizing.
5. Finishing Techniques for Enhanced Aesthetics
A well-finished aluminium enclosure not only protects components but also enhances the overall look of the product. Various finishing techniques can be employed to achieve the desired effect:
Anodizing
Anodizing increases corrosion resistance and provides a beautiful finish. This electrochemical process can add color and texture while preserving the metallic look of aluminium.
Powder Coating
Powder coating offers a durable finish that can withstand harsh environments. Available in many colors and textures, it provides an excellent aesthetic while enhancing protection against wear and tear.
Brushing
Brushing creates a textured appearance that can enhance grip and provide a sophisticated look. This technique can be combined with anodizing for both durability and style.
6. Applications of Custom Aluminium Enclosures
Custom aluminium enclosures have widespread application across various industries:
Electronics
In the electronics industry, custom enclosures safeguard sensitive components from environmental factors while enabling optimal heat dissipation.
Automotive
Automotive applications often require lightweight yet robust enclosures for components like control units and sensors. Custom solutions can enhance both performance and reliability.
Aerospace
In aerospace, where weight and durability are critical, custom aluminium enclosures provide the necessary protection and support for sophisticated systems.
Industrial Equipment
Industrial equipment often operates under extreme conditions. Custom enclosures can offer additional protection against dust, moisture, and temperature fluctuations.

8. Frequently Asked Questions
What is the lead time for custom aluminium extrusions?
The lead time for custom aluminium extrusions can vary depending on the complexity of the design and the manufacturer's capabilities. Typically, it ranges from a few weeks to several months.
Can I order small quantities of custom extrusions?
Many manufacturers offer the option to order small quantities, although cost per unit may be higher compared to bulk orders.
What are the best practices for designing custom enclosures?
Best practices include considering thermal management, accessibility, and potential mounting solutions to enhance functionality and usability.
How do I choose the right surface finish for my enclosure?
The choice of surface finish depends on the intended application and environmental conditions. Anodizing is great for corrosion resistance, while powder coating offers aesthetic versatility.
Are there any sustainability considerations for aluminium enclosures?
Aluminium is highly recyclable and can be sourced sustainably, making it an environmentally friendly option. Many manufacturers are now focusing on sustainable practices in their production processes.
